Kylebooker Fishing Waders for Men & Women: A Budget-Friendly Choice?

For anglers who prioritize comfort and durability in their fishing gear, waders are an essential investment. The Kylebooker Fishing Waders for Men and Women (2-Ply Nylon/PVC, M10/W12 Green) have gained attention for their affordability, but how do they perform in terms of value for money? This review explores their features, pros, cons, and overall性价比 (cost-performance ratio) to help you decide if they’re worth purchasing.

Key Features
1. Material & Durability
These waders are constructed from 2-ply nylon/PVC, a common choice for budget-friendly waders. The material is lightweight and offers decent water resistance, though it may not match the longevity of premium 3- or 4-layer fabrics. The seams are taped to prevent leaks, but long-term durability under heavy use (e.g., rocky terrains) could be a concern.

2. Fit & Comfort
Available in unisex sizes (Men’s 10/Women’s 12), the waders feature an adjustable chest-high design with suspenders for a secure fit. The nylon interior is breathable, reducing sweat buildup during extended wear. However, some users report limited mobility in the knee area, which could affect comfort during active fishing.

3. Functionality
– Pockets: A front pocket provides storage for small tackle items, though it lacks additional compartments.
– Boot Attachments: Unlike stockingfoot waders, these come with integrated boots, saving the cost of separate wading shoes. However, the tread may lack grip on slippery surfaces.

4. Price Point
Priced significantly lower than brands like Simms or Frogg Toggs, the Kylebooker waders target budget-conscious anglers. At around $50–$70, they’re a steal for occasional use but may not endure frequent, rough conditions.

性价比 (Cost-Performance Ratio)
For occasional freshwater fishing (e.g., streams, lakes), these waders offer solid value. They outperform cheaper PVC-only waders in breathability and are a practical choice for mild conditions. However, serious anglers or those facing harsh environments (saltwater, thorny brush) should invest in reinforced neoprene or Gore-Tex alternatives.

1. Build Quality and Materials
The Hodgman Caster waders are constructed from a neoprene and nylon blend, a combination known for its balance of flexibility, insulation, and abrasion resistance. Neoprene provides excellent thermal retention, making these waders suitable for cold-water fishing, while the nylon overlay enhances durability against rough terrains like rocky riverbeds or dense brush.

The bootfoot design integrates rugged rubber boots, eliminating the need for separate wading shoes. The boots are reinforced with thick soles for grip and protection, a crucial feature for slippery surfaces. Being Made in Taiwan, the craftsmanship aligns with reputable manufacturing standards, often associated with reliable outdoor gear.

2. Comfort and Fit
Available in Size L, these waders cater to a broad range of body types. The adjustable suspenders and belt loops ensure a secure fit, preventing water from seeping in during deep wading. The neoprene material offers a snug yet flexible fit, allowing freedom of movement for casting and hiking to remote fishing spots.

However, some users note that the bootfoot design may feel bulky compared to stockingfoot waders paired with separate boots. While this is subjective, it’s worth considering if you prioritize lightweight mobility.

3. Performance in the Field
– Waterproofing: The seams are tightly sealed, and the reinforced knees and seat add extra protection against leaks.
– Insulation: The 3-5mm neoprene thickness is ideal for temperate to cold climates, though it may feel too warm in summer.
– Traction: The boot soles perform well on wet rocks but lack specialized treads like Vibram, which premium brands often use.
